Output 570a70af1064675b61176849fe48582b90d59f2892cfc881913023e1dc122907:0

value
35290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a6660ebdcfd7cfe1c013150c0f1d8b6eb6ff085 OP_EQUAL
address
35ZCwzPweDrQEHJpQySCCnJAPc3UWwaCjA
transaction
570a70af1064675b61176849fe48582b90d59f2892cfc881913023e1dc122907
spent
true